About

Timothy Sakellaridis is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Emergency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Timothy Sakellaridis has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 351 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Surgery, 9 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 5 papers in Emergency Medicine. Recurrent topics in Timothy Sakellaridis's work include Trauma Management and Diagnosis (5 papers),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(4 papers) and Pneumothorax, Barotrauma, Emphysema (3 papers). Timothy Sakellaridis is often cited by papers focused on Trauma Management and Diagnosis (5 papers),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(4 papers) and Pneumothorax, Barotrauma, Emphysema (3 papers). Timothy Sakellaridis collaborates with scholars based in Greece. Timothy Sakellaridis's co-authors include Paul Zarogoulidis, Christos Charitos, Mihalis Argiriou, Ioanna Kougioumtzi, Theodora Tsiouda, Nikolaos Machairiotis, Nikolaos Katsikogiannis, Kosmas Tsakiridis, Ioannis Karanikas and Christoph Alexiou and has published in prestigious journals such as British Journal of Sports Medicine, The Annals of Thoracic Surgery and Transactions of the Royal Society of Tropical Medicine and Hygiene.
